Outward Bound

It is June1985 and I am a participant in a 28 day Outward Bound Course on Hurricane Island in Maine. All the members of the group I'm a part of are required to plunge daily into the frigid ocean. Quite a way to start the day!! A week passes and the other members of the group have grow weary of my shenanigans and stage an intervention. I'm furious at them for calling me on my behaviors but I listen to what they have to say. I hear that they feel I'm not being a good team member. I learn that my self-centeredness is hurting the group. It's a very uncomfortable learning experience but this lesson is burned deeply into me, so deeply that I remember it clearly today as if it happened a few months ago. I learn that when people care they speak up and call me on my behaviors. They don't keep silent and enable me to continue on the wrong path.
